Logic: Techniques Of Formal Reasoning
Delivery time: 8-12 business days (International)
Logic: Techniques Of Formal Reasoning, 2/E Is An Introductory Volume That Teaches Students To Recognize And Construct Correct Deductions. It Takes Students Through All Logical Stepsfrom Premise To Conclusionand Presents Appropriate Symbols And Terms, While Giving Examples To Clarify Principles. Logic, 2/E Uses Models To Establish The Invalidity Of Arguments, And Includes Exercise Sets Throughout, Ranging From Easy To Challenging. Solutions Are Provided To Selected Exercises, And Historical Remarks Discuss Major Contributions To The Theories Covered.
